Driving directions:

From M42

Leave the M42 at junction 2 (signposted Birmingham South & Hopwood Park Services), then at roundabout take the exit onto the A441 (signposted Redditch).

Head down the A441, until you see a Citreon Garage/Total Petrol Station on the right (should only be 5 mins down the A441). Immediately after at the traffic lights, turn *left* into Dagnell End Lane, then right into Meadow Farm straight after. Simple!
